Title: Seishi Utsuno: Innovator in Magnetic Core Technology

Introduction

Seishi Utsuno is a prominent inventor based in Nagakute,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of magnetic core technology, holding a total of 5 patents. His work focuses on developing advanced materials that enhance the efficiency of magnetic cores, which are essential components in various electrical devices.

Latest Patents

Utsuno's latest patents include innovations such as a compressed powder magnetic core and a powder for magnetic cores, along with their production methods. One of his notable inventions is a dust core designed to significantly reduce iron loss. This dust core comprises soft magnetic particles made of pure iron or an iron alloy, with a grain boundary layer existing between adjacent particles. The grain boundary layer features a compound layer that includes MFeSiO, where M represents one or more types of metal elements serving as divalent cations. The dust core is produced by annealing a compact obtained through compression-molding a powder for magnetic cores. The resulting dust core exhibits high specific resistance, effectively reducing both eddy-current loss and hysteresis loss.

Career Highlights

Throughout his career, Seishi Utsuno has worked with notable companies such as Denso Corporation and Toyota Motor Corporation. His experience in these leading organizations has allowed him to refine his expertise in magnetic materials and their applications in the automotive and electronics industries.

Collaborations

Utsuno has collaborated with esteemed colleagues, including Jung Hwan Hwang and Ken Matsubara. These partnerships have contributed to the advancement of his research and the successful development of innovative magnetic core technologies.
